Why Standard Gym Packages Fail on Cruise Ships?
The core reason most off-the-shelf fitness equipment fails in maritime environments is the mismatch between land-based assumptions and marine realities. A treadmill designed for a climate-controlled gym in Osaka behaves differently when placed on a steel deck subject to constant micro-vibrations and humidity fluctuations.

In one case, a buyer attempted to save costs by using a standard Cardio Zone Layout Package Wholesale intended for a hotel chain. The treadmills were installed on the upper deck. Within months, guests complained of a low-frequency hum that permeated the cabins below. The issue was not the motors but the lack of proper isolation. Standard rubber feet transmitted the kinetic energy directly into the ship’s hull. By switching to specialized isolation pads, we reduced the structure-borne noise noticeably, resolving the complaint without replacing the units.
Another critical failure point is corrosion. The air at sea is laden with salt. Without specific treatments, even stainless steel components can suffer from pitting. I have seen control panels corrode to the point of short-circuiting because the manufacturer used standard industrial coating instead of marine-grade finishes. Key Technical Specs for Japan-Route Cruises?
When specifying equipment for routes involving Japanese ports, the focus must shift from aesthetic trends to material resilience and regulatory compliance. The humid, salty air of the Pacific and the strict enforcement of safety codes by ClassNK demand a higher tier of engineering.
Salt-spray resistance is not optional. Metal finishes must withstand prolonged exposure to saline mist. We adhere to testing protocols equivalent to ASTM B117, ensuring that frames and fasteners do not degrade. This is particularly important for the external casings of cardio machines, which are often near large windows or ventilation intakes.
Electronics require special attention. High humidity levels, often exceeding 90% in tropical zones, can penetrate standard enclosures. We apply conformal coatings to printed circuit boards (PCBs) to protect against moisture and corrosion. This layer acts as a barrier, preventing short circuits and extending the lifespan of the console and motor controllers. Fire safety is another non-negotiable aspect. The International Maritime Organization (IMO) has strict guidelines regarding the flammability of materials used on ships. Upholstery, foam padding, and plastic components must meet specific fire-retardant standards. Using non-compliant materials can lead to the rejection of the entire shipment at the port. A common misconception is that compact equipment is lighter and therefore better for ships. In reality, maritime gear often needs heavier steel frames to dampen the vibration induced by vessel motion. Lighter frames may resonate with the ship’s frequency, causing discomfort and potential structural fatigue. How to Optimize Layout for Limited Deck Space?
Space on a cruise ship is at a premium. Every square meter must be utilized efficiently without compromising safety or accessibility. Designing a Cardio Zone Layout Package Wholesale for a vessel requires a modular approach that maximizes throughput while minimizing footprint.
We start by mapping the cardio footprint to the deck’s load limits. Different decks have different weight-bearing capacities, measured in kg/m². Overloading a deck can compromise the ship’s structural integrity. By selecting equipment with optimized weight distribution, we ensure compliance with naval architecture constraints.
Service clearance is another critical factor. Technicians need access to the internal components of machines for maintenance. In luxury suites or tight corridors, leaving insufficient space can make repairs impossible without removing the unit. We recommend a minimum service clearance around elliptical drive systems and treadmill motors to allow onboard technicians to perform routine checks.
Modular, multi-functional units are ideal for these constrained spaces. A single unit that combines multiple cardio functions can reduce the overall footprint while offering variety to users. For example, a hybrid elliptical-rower can serve two different user preferences in the space of one traditional machine. What Documentation Ensures Smooth Customs Clearance?
Paperwork is as important as the hardware when importing fitness equipment into Japan. Missing or incorrect documentation can delay clearance for weeks, incurring storage fees and disrupting the ship’s schedule. For a Cardio Zone Layout Package Wholesale, pre-verifying all certificates is essential.
Class Society certificates are the primary requirement. Bodies like ClassNK or DNV must approve the equipment for marine use. These certificates confirm that the design and materials meet the necessary safety and structural standards. Without them, the equipment cannot be legally installed on a registered vessel.
Fire test reports are equally critical. As mentioned earlier, all materials must comply with IMO regulations. Providing detailed test reports from accredited laboratories ensures that customs officials and port inspectors can verify compliance quickly. Self-reported data is not sufficient; third-party verification is mandatory.
Additionally, detailed technical manuals and maintenance guides in both English and Japanese facilitate smoother operations for the onboard crew. Clear instructions on installation, operation, and troubleshooting reduce the likelihood of user error and equipment damage.
